Indiana's Native Bees Hike at Mary Gray

A guided nature hike focusing on Indiana's native bee species at the Mary Gray Bird Sanctuary.

Sat, 20 Jun 2026 10:00 AM (America/Indiana/Indianapolis) Mary Gray Bird Sanctuary Connersville , Indiana
Explore the beautiful trails of the Mary Gray Bird Sanctuary while discovering the fascinating world of Indiana's diverse native bees. This guided hike offers a unique opportunity to learn about local pollinators, their habitats, and their critical role in our ecosystem. Led by experts from the Indiana Audubon, participants will gain insights into bee identification and conservation efforts. Join us for an educational morning in nature at this premier bird and wildlife sanctuary.
